Innovative curriculum development involves designing and implementing new, creative, and effective educational curricula that enhance student engagement, foster critical thinking, and adapt to the evolving needs of society. It emphasizes integrating technology, interdisciplinary approaches, real-world applications, and personalized learning pathways to improve educational outcomes.
Key Features
- Integration of emerging technology and digital tools
- Emphasis on student-centered and personalized learning
- Interdisciplinary and project-based approaches
- Focus on developing critical thinking, creativity, and problem-solving skills
- Flexibility to adapt to diverse learner needs and societal changes
- Alignment with current industry trends and future skill requirements
Pros
- Enhances student engagement and motivation
- Prepares learners for the demands of modern workplaces
- Encourages creativity and independent thinking
- Supports inclusive education through adaptable frameworks
- Facilitates continuous improvement in teaching practices
Cons
- Implementation can be resource-intensive and costly
- Requires extensive teacher training and professional development
- Potential resistance to change from traditional educational institutions
- Difficulty in standardizing innovative methods across different settings
